Scotts Miracle-Gro products used for this overhaul:
- Scotts® ez Seed® (1-0-0) :: we were nervous about growing grass atop a bed of concrete (around each cedar post we installed) so we knew we had to go for a guarantee. We used the Scotts ez Seed to grow grass at the base of each post. Sprinkled the 3-in-1 mix (mulch, seed and fertilizer), watered it well and watched the magic happen.
- Miracle-Gro Moisture Control Potting Mix :: our original plan was to use Scotts Premium Garden Soil however after further investigation and helpful advice from one of the Scotts pro’s, we found out that this soil is for in-ground gardens, not potted plants. We used Miracle-Gro Moisture Control Potting Mix for all the pots and hanging baskets on our patio for reasons I just have to explain, it’s actually really cool. This potting soil has an AquaCoir® technology which allows the soil to hold 33% more water than regular potting mix and releases it as the roots need it. We knew this would be the best way to start off our plants considering the heat we’ve been having here in Vancouver early on this Summer and also this will give us a great sense of relief when we are away on vacation sporadically this summer.
- Miracle-Gro® Shake ‘n Feed® All Purpose Continuous Release Plant Food :: because bigger is better! Who doesn’t want to see their flowers and plants grow bigger than the traditional size? Here is how we looked at it, a bigger more luscious plant means it takes up more space in the pot which in turn means less money spent on an abundance of filler plants. It’s super easy to use, and you only have to reapply once every 4 months during the growing season! (which amounts to about 1x/year, since our growing season is notoriously short).
- Scotts® Outdoor Cleaner Plus OxiClean™ Ready to Use :: we used this product for 2 reasons; 1. we had stains on the concrete from pots that had lived there long before, and 2. we needed to find a cleaner that was not only safe for the plants and grass we would be spraying near but also safe for the concrete. We wanted it cleaned, but cleaned right, and that’s exactly what we found in Scotts Outdoor Cleaner.
